The Nature Of Real Estate Disputes

According to the law, when engaging in a real estate transaction, the seller has an obligation to disclose known problems to potential buyers.

The seller must also inform on actions taken to remedy the issue. However, disputes often arise over problems that were purposefully not disclosed, as well as unknown problems that the seller may or may not have been legally responsible for knowing about.
